Negative keywords are just as important to the success of your paid search account as positive keywords. At their basic level, negatives are filtering words – they stop your ads from showing. At a more crucial level, they can keep your ads from wasting money and impressions on irrelevant search queries, which leads to: Increased […]

Using all appropriate ad extensions is crucial to managing your PPC accounts. Ad Extensions are not only used in determining ad rank, they allow users to interact with your ads in various ways such as calling you directly from an ad to deep linking to appropriate pages. Most articles on Quality Score are a bit confusing as what you see inside of the AdWords interface and what the articles mention (lowering CPCs, raising positions) are based upon two entirely different numbers. Quality Score, along with your ad extensions and bid determine your ad rank; how high your ad is positioned compared to […]
